IMEG is hiring a Survey Technician in Billings, MT, to support land surveying office production and field activities. In this entry-level role, you will help process incoming information, support office and field staff, and contribute to final land surveying project deliverables under the leadership of a Senior Survey Coordinator. You'll also support accurate, standards-based survey workflows that help meet client and project needs.

Principal Responsibilities

* Process survey data using IMEG CAD standards while helping ensure accuracy and compliance with applicable land survey project and professional standards under the direction of your supervisor and a licensed professional
* Monitor field crew production and support quality assurance efforts
* Research historical maps, land records, previous surveys, and land title reports
* Provide survey computations, staking/control exhibits, and survey crew instructions for construction staking and field survey projects
* Prepare cadastral, existing conditions, and platting documents from field and office data using AutoCAD Civil software
* Carry out initial quality control of field deliverables according to standards and best practices
* Coordinate with your supervisor to help meet client-specific demands
* Act as a field technician as requested to complete survey field work
* Maintain professional and productive working relationships with clients and coworkers
* Observe safety and security procedures

Required Qualifications and Skills

* Associate degree, or certificate, in Land Surveying or Engineering preferred
* Prior experience in the land surveying, consulting or construction industry is preferred
* Work to gain knowledge of survey operations, principles, and practices
* Knowledge of engineering plans and construction documents
* Knowledgeable of office workflow processes and problem-solving techniques
* Strong computer and technical skills; AutoCAD or similar applications are a plus
* Proficiency in technical math, geometry, and trigonometry is recommended
* Possess basic oral and written communication skills
* Ability to communicate with clients, coworkers and professionally represent IMEG
* Valid driver's license with ability to be insured by IMEG carrier; must consent to a Motor Vehicle Record (MVR) background check
* Proficient in Microsoft and MS Office Suite including but not limited to Word, Excel, and Outlook
* Ability to travel with occasional overnight stays

Civil Team Highlights

* IMEG's survey group includes 100+ professionals, including licensed surveyors, delivering responsive and reliable surveying solutions
* The team has experience with topographic surveys, subsurface utility surveys, geodetic and boundary surveys, right-of-way mapping, and land acquisition services
* IMEG's survey professionals support both private and public clients, including municipalities, DOTs, and federal agencies
* The team uses advanced technology such as 3D scanners, laser scanners, drones, and Subsurface Utility Engineering (SUE) tools to support accurate project delivery
